The Seattle Seahawks have high hopes for the 2018 season after missing the playoffs for the first time since 2011.

The NFL has released the opponents for the upcoming season and the schedule is expected to be revealed closer to the NFL Draft. For now, one thing is certain – the Seahawks’ schedule won’t be an easy one.

John Breech of CBSSports.com took a look at the opponents around the league for all 32 teams and ranked the strength of schedule for each ball club. The Seahawks find themselves in a three-team time with the Browns and the Rams.

The Seahawks 2018 opponents finished with a combined record of 134-122 and a .523 winning percentage last season. Four of those teams made the playoffs, including the Division-Champion Rams, Vikings and Chiefs. Seattle will also face the Panthers, who earned a Wild Card berth.

If it’s any consolation, Seattle will square off twice against the Rams, a team battling an equally challenging schedule.

According to Breech, the Packers have the toughest road in 2018, followed by the Lions and Saints, who are tied for second place.
